Office Administration

  • Part Time Senior Accountant

    We are seeking a professional Part Time Senior Accountant for a client based in Greenville, SC. This role is mostly remote, however, this candidate must be located within driving distance of Greenville, SC due to onsite client meetings.   

    This is a part time (20-25 hours a week) position.  

    Job Description: 

    Analyze and record journal entries 
    Update depreciation schedules  
    Prepare and organize work papers for Form 990s 
    Assist with audit facilitation, forecasting, and grant management 
    Serve as an accounting lead for 4-6 clients and manage bookkeeping tasks 
    Prepare information for 990 filings and file 1099s 

    Qualifications: 

    Bachelors Degree in Accounting, Finance, or Business Administration  
    4-5 years of general accounting experience, preferably managing multiple books  
    Experience with non profit accounting (REQUIRED) 
    Strong QuickBooks experience  
    Excellent Excel Skills (including Pivot Tables & V Lookups) 

    Hours: 

    Monday to Friday  
    PART TIME – Flexible hours  
    MUST be willing to work 20-25 hours per week 

    Compensation & Additional Information: 

    $35 – $40 hourly  
    Eligible for up to 3 weeks of PTO  
    90% Remote – 10% Onsite for client meetings  
    Must live within driving distance of Greenville, SC 
    Technology stipend  

  • HR Generalist

    We’re seeking an experienced HR Generalist to provide comprehensive human resources support across all key HR functions. This role will assist with employee relations, performance management, onboarding, benefits administration, and compliance.

    The ideal candidate will combine strong administrative capability with sound HR judgment and confidentiality.

    Key Responsibilities:

    Administer and maintain HR policies, procedures,…

  • Accountant

    We are seeking an experienced Accountant for an established company in Greenville, SC. This is a full time, permanent position that is onsite.        
      
    Responsibilities:       

    Process financial transactions such as bank deposits and cash receipts
    Prepare monthly balance sheet account reconciliations
    Review and resolve accounting discrepancies including job cost variances
    Manage asset accounting, including monitoring fixed…

  • Corporate Paralegal

    We are seeking a Corporate Paralegal to support an attorney in managing LLC formations, compliance, and corporate entity maintenance. This is a full-time, onsite position with a small, busy legal team, real estate experience is a plus, but not required.
     
    This role is 100% onsite.
     
    Description:

    Support the legal team with a variety…

  • Administrative Assistant

    Our client is seeking a skilled Administrative Assistant to provide high-level support in a fast-paced, professional environment. The ideal candidate will be highly organized, tech-savvy, and comfortable managing multiple priorities with accuracy and attention to detail. This is a contract position lasting approximately 3 to 6 months, with a standard…

  • CNC Machine Operator

    Our client in Greenville, SC is seeking an experienced CNC Machine Operator to join their team. This role is full-time (Friday – Sunday 6pm – 6am), has starting pay of $27hr, and is a permanent opportunity with benefits.

    Responsibilities:

    Change tooling to maintain set up defined by the planning documents.
    Operate machines to…

  • Service Coordinator

    We are seeking a detail-oriented and proactive Service Coordinator to manage technician schedules, customer service requests, and accurate job quotes for installations, repairs, and parts. This role supports the division manager to ensure smooth operations, efficient resource use, and high customer satisfaction.
     
    Responsibilities

    Coordinate daily technician schedules, confirm appointments, and adjust for…

  • Commercial Lines Account Manager

    A well-known insurance agency in Irmo, SC is looking to add another Commercial Lines Account Manager to their team. The ideal candidate has prior insurance experience, communicates professionally and maintains a positive attitude. Must have property & casualty license!
     
    Responsibilities: 

    Educate clients on the insurance policies that best suit their needs
    Provide policies to new…